Dance Companies of Singapore

In 1988, the Singapore Dance Theater was created. Ther first performance of this company wasn’t until March of 2005. Although it is a relative new company, this is Singapore’s most notable and premiere ballet company. The choreographer is varied and the training strict. Performances include everything by well known contemporary and modern dance guest choreographers to the classics such as the Nutcracker and Romeo and Juliet. The Singapore company trains with and has an alliance with the Australian Ballet. Through working with such a technically sound and older more experienced dance company, Singapore Dance Theater is becoming very well known and very beloved and frequented by travellers staying at some of the best hotels in Singapore. Once a year the company presents a festival series. This is all outside, in the park where audience members have picnics and wine while the ballet happens around them. The festival, called Ballet Under the Stars, has become quite a popular event.

Some of the modern companies, a little more on the edge, include the Odyssey Dance Theatre and The Arts Company. Also well known is the company EcNad. Both of these companies offer creative alternatives to traditional ballet and performances tend to be very high energy .

There are also companies of various traditional styles of dance. One such company out of Singapore is called Sri Warisan. This company was created and founded in 1997. This company is the leader on the scene of traditional Malay dance companies. The choreography is often times a mix of traditional and more modern contemporary styles. The performers, about 30, are trained in all disciplines, dance but also including theater, music and multi-media technology. Along with the performers, the company includes a group of 15 full time office workers, and more than 250 students. All are dedicated to opening dance and the understanding of performance art to the general public, of all ages. This company is involved year round in various festivals all around the world and teach workshops and are involved in many different out reach programs and the support of various local and international causes.
